Màj Aptitude bloqué

Bonjour à tous,

Actuelement sous aptitude, un paquet bloque les màj, il concerne virtualbox dont voici le retour:

[quote]dpkg-query: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string 1.6.6-35336_Debian_lenny': invalid character in revision number dpkg: parse error, in file '/var/lib/dpkg/status' near line 7410 package 'virtualbox': error in Version string1.6.6-35336_Debian_lenny’: invalid character in revision number
E: Sub-process /usr/bin/dpkg returned an error code (2)
A package failed to install. Trying to recover:
dpkg: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string `1.6.6-35336_Debian_lenny’: invalid character in revision number[/quote]

Je suis allé voir le fichier /var/lib/dpkg/status à la ligne 7410: (la ligne 7410 en en gras)

[quote]Package: virtualbox
Status: install ok installed
Priority: optional
Section: misc
Installed-Size: 55120
Maintainer: Sun Microsystems, Inc. info@virtualbox.org
Architecture: amd64
Version: 1.6.6-35336_Debian_lenny
Config-Version: 1.6.6-35336_Debian_lenny
Depends: libc6 (>= 2.7-1), libgcc1 (>= 1:4.1.1), libglib2.0-0 (>= 2.12.0), libidl0, libqt3-mt (>= 3:3.3.8b), libsdl1.2debian (>= 1.2.10-1), libssl0.9.8 (>= 0.9.8f-5), libstdc++6 (>= 4.2.1), libx11-6, libxcursor1 (>> 1.1.2), libxml2 (>= 2.6.27), libxslt1.1 (>= 1.1.18), libxt6, psmisc, adduser
Pre-Depends: debconf (>= 1.1) | debconf-2.0
Recommends: libasound2, libpulse0, libsdl-ttf2.0-0, linux-headers, gcc, make, binutils, bridge-utils, uml-utilities, libhal1 (>= 0.5), pdf-viewer
Conffiles:
/etc/init.d/vboxnet 350fa9e6723b4fabbadf7874fdc70d67
/etc/init.d/vboxdrv 6e3cb8dd230d768740ce0c6e0ae6a86c
Description: Sun xVM VirtualBox
VirtualBox is a powerful PC virtualization solution allowing you to run a
wide range of PC operating systems on your Linux system. This includes
Windows, Linux, FreeBSD, DOS, OpenBSD and others. VirtualBox comes with a broad
feature set and excellent performance, making it the premier virtualization
software solution on the market.[/quote]

J’ai tenté des --reconfigure, remove -f virtualbox voir installer le .deb de la version 3.2 (je suis en 3.1), rien n’a fonctionné, j’ai toujours ce message qui me revient.
Du coup, toutes mes màj sont bloquées, auriez-vous une idée qui permettrait un blocage du bazard, svp?

Cordialement

j’ai regarder vite fait via gooogle , il conseille de faire un purge de VB avant d’en installer un autre, le bug est connu mais apparement fixer …

vois si tu ne trouve pas ton bonheur ici :

google.com/search?q=Version% … bian_lenny

google.com/search?hl=en&&sa= … ny&spell=1

:006

[quote=“Grhim”]j’ai regarder vite fait via gooogle , il conseille de faire un purge de VB avant d’en installer un autre, le bug est connu mais apparement fixer …

vois si tu ne trouve pas ton bonheur ici :

google.com/search?q=Version% … bian_lenny

google.com/search?hl=en&&sa= … ny&spell=1

:006[/quote]

OUi, j’ai fait ces recherches également, sauf, que je peux pas le virer. S’aurait été trop facile sinon :confused:
Aptitude est bloqué par un paquet que je peux pas virer, donc voilà, c’est la mouise …

[quote]debian:/home/belette# aptitude -f remove virtualbox-3.1
The following packages will be REMOVED:
libcurl3{u} libssh2-1{u} virtualbox-3.1
The following partially installed packages will be configured:
dpkg dpkg-dev libdpkg-perl
0 packages upgraded, 0 newly installed, 3 to remove and 40 not upgraded.
Need to get 0B of archives. After unpacking 93.3MB will be freed.
Do you want to continue? [Y/n/?] y
dpkg-query: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string 1.6.6-35336_Debian_lenny': invalid character in revision number dpkg: parse error, in file '/var/lib/dpkg/status' near line 7410 package 'virtualbox': error in Version string1.6.6-35336_Debian_lenny’: invalid character in revision number
E: Sub-process /usr/bin/dpkg returned an error code (2)
A package failed to install. Trying to recover:
dpkg: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string `1.6.6-35336_Debian_lenny’: invalid character in revision number

debian:/home/belette# [/quote]

Ou ça aussi:

[quote]debian:/home/belette# dpkg --force-all --purge virtualbox
dpkg: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string `1.6.6-35336_Debian_lenny’: invalid character in revision number
debian:/home/belette# [/quote]

Voir ceci également:

[quote]debian:/home/belette# aptitude -f install virtualbox-3.2
The following NEW packages will be installed:
virtualbox-3.2{b}
The following partially installed packages will be configured:
dpkg dpkg-dev libdpkg-perl
0 packages upgraded, 1 newly installed, 0 to remove and 40 not upgraded.
Need to get 0B/49.9MB of archives. After unpacking 100MB will be used.
The following packages have unmet dependencies:
virtualbox-3.1: Conflicts: virtualbox but 1.6.6-35336_Debian_lenny is installed.
virtualbox-3.2: Conflicts: virtualbox but 1.6.6-35336_Debian_lenny is installed.
The following actions will resolve these dependencies:

 Remove the following packages:
  1. virtualbox                  
    
  2. virtualbox-3.1              
    

Accept this solution? [Y/n/q/?] y
The following NEW packages will be installed:
virtualbox-3.2
The following packages will be REMOVED:
virtualbox{a} virtualbox-3.1{a}
The following partially installed packages will be configured:
dpkg dpkg-dev libdpkg-perl
0 packages upgraded, 1 newly installed, 2 to remove and 40 not upgraded.
Need to get 0B/49.9MB of archives. After unpacking 48.5MB will be freed.
Do you want to continue? [Y/n/?] y
dpkg-query: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string 1.6.6-35336_Debian_lenny': invalid character in revision number Reading package fields... Done Reading package status... Done Retrieving bug reports... Done Parsing Found/Fixed information... Done Preconfiguring packages ... dpkg: parse error, in file '/var/lib/dpkg/status' near line 7410 package 'virtualbox': error in Version string1.6.6-35336_Debian_lenny’: invalid character in revision number
localepurge: Disk space freed in /usr/share/locale: 0 KiB
localepurge: Disk space freed in /usr/share/man: 0 KiB
localepurge: Disk space freed in /usr/share/gnome/help: 0 KiB
localepurge: Disk space freed in /usr/share/omf: 0 KiB

Total disk space freed by localepurge: 0 KiB

E: Sub-process /usr/bin/dpkg returned an error code (2)
A package failed to install. Trying to recover:
dpkg: parse error, in file ‘/var/lib/dpkg/status’ near line 7410 package ‘virtualbox’:
error in Version string `1.6.6-35336_Debian_lenny’: invalid character in revision number

debian:/home/belette#
[/quote]

:017

Salut,
Je crois avoir sensiblement le même problème…

dpkg-query: erreur d'analyse, dans le fichier '/var/lib/dpkg/available' vers la ligne 32627 paquet 'virtualbox-3.1': erreur dans la chaîne Version « 3.1.2-56127_Debian_lenny » : invalid character in revision number Lecture des champs des paquets... Fait Lecture de l'état des paquets... Fait Récupération des rapports de bogue... Fait Analyse des informations Trouvé/Corrigé... Fait Lecture des fichiers de modifications (« changelog »)... Terminé Extraction des modèles depuis les paquets : 100% Préconfiguration des paquets... dpkg: erreur d'analyse, dans le fichier '/var/lib/dpkg/available' vers la ligne 32627 paquet 'virtualbox-3.1': erreur dans la chaîne Version « 3.1.2-56127_Debian_lenny » : invalid character in revision number E: Sub-process /usr/bin/dpkg returned an error code (2)

C’est arrivé cet après-midi suite au remplacement de virtualbox ose par virtualbox non-ose (j’avais besoin de l’USB dans Vbox).
Virtualbox est bien installé, mais ça m’a mis le bronx dans dpkg…
Je n’ai pas eu le temps de regarder, mais dés que j’ai un “cheat code” je te le donne :wink:
A moins que tu ne sois plus rapide…

Re,
Résolu pour moi…

Je suis allé fouiner dans le fichier /var/lib/dpkg/available ligne 32627 (c’est loin… :mrgreen: )
J’ai effacé ce qui concerne “virtualbox-3.1”… Terminé!

Comme c’est le 3.2 qui est installé, même pas la peine de réinstaller :smiley:

:006

[quote]Je suis allé fouiner dans le fichier /var/lib/dpkg/available ligne 32627 (c’est loin… :mrgreen: )
J’ai effacé ce qui concerne “virtualbox-3.1”… Terminé!
:smiley:
[/quote]

ha goooood ça etrrrre trrres bon haaaack !!! +1 :023

:041

Salut,

[quote=“Grhim”]
ha goooood ça etrrrre trrres bon haaaack !!! +1 :023

:041[/quote]

:mrgreen:

C’est pas dpkg qui va me faire chier quand même! :005

PS : Je suis allé voir le site de backtrack (Cf ton post ou tu parle de problèmes Wifi) ça a l’air chouette! Je teste ça dés que j’ai téléchargé l’Iso! Désolé j’ai pas d’idée au sujet de ton pb… :006

[quote=“lol”]Re,
Résolu pour moi…

Je suis allé fouiner dans le fichier /var/lib/dpkg/available ligne 32627 (c’est loin… :mrgreen: )
J’ai effacé ce qui concerne “virtualbox-3.1”… Terminé!

Comme c’est le 3.2 qui est installé, même pas la peine de réinstaller :smiley:

:006[/quote]

Alors là, chapeau :023
Rapide, radical et efficace. Tout est rentré dans l’ordre :007
J’ai été un peu timide sur ce coup là :mrgreen:

:023

[quote=“Gargamel”]
Alors là, chapeau :023
Rapide, radical et efficace. Tout est rentré dans l’ordre :007
J’ai été un peu timide sur ce coup là :mrgreen:

:023[/quote]

Oui c’est un peu radical.
Je pense que ce qui s’est passé pour toi et moi, c’est une mauvaise mise à jour de la base de apt, c’est rare, mais chiant. Au moindre grain de sable APT bloque. Plus aucune opération possible sur le moindre paquet. Ça assure la stabilité…

J’ai oublié de préciser que pour ce genre de manip, une sauvegarde préalable du fichier que l’on va “modifier” est indispensable.

APT n’aime pas toujours ce genre de manip, la prudence reste de mise :006

J’ai eut le problème il y a 2/3 jours.
J’ai fait la même manip … pour info il y a une sauvegarde automatique de l’ancien fichier (.old)
Sinon j’ai même fait plus en vidant complètement le fichier :105
Et je n’ai pas eut de problème, ni par synaptique, ni par aptitude. Pour être sur j’ai installer/désintallé des packets et aucun problème :mrgreen:

pour mon soucie , toujours pareil il charge et …il charge …
je vais changer le dns avec ceux de opendns on verras bien …

sinon oui essais backtrack(je prefere la 3 (base slackware) mais la 4 est en base debian-'buntu maintenant tu me diras laquel tu prefere)

:slight_smile:

[quote=“Grhim”]…
pour mon soucie , toujours pareil il charge et …il charge …
je vais changer le dns avec ceux de opendns on verras bien …

sinon oui essais backtrack(je prefere la 3 (base slackware) mais la 4 est en base debian-'buntu maintenant tu me diras laquel tu prefere)

:)[/quote]

:mrgreen: Je viens de me cogner plus d’1 Go pour la 4… Mais comme je ne connais pas slackware, c’est l’occase :023

Merci!

attention backtrack 4 est basé sur debian buntu , c’est backtrack 3 qui est en slackware :slight_smile:

Re,

[quote=“Grhim”][quote]
:mrgreen: Je viens de me cogner plus d’1 Go pour la 4… Mais comme je ne connais pas slackware, c’est l’occase :023
[/quote]

attention backtrack 4 est basé sur debian buntu , c’est backtrack 3 qui est en slackware :)[/quote]

Oui, c’est bien ce que j’avais compris. Il me “reste” la 3 à essayer… En tout cas la 4 est belle et bien foutue… plein d’outils coooool dedans!

tu m’etonne , j’aime beaucoup cette distrib d’audit internet :wink: :wink: ya plus qu’a … héhé :wink: :wink:

au faite sur la 4 compiz est present ??? pour le wifi , je sais que ce n’est plus wireless assistant/network manager dedans mais wicd par contre par rapport a la 3 la 4 a eu du mal a se connecter en wifi mais bon !!! :wink:

tu m’etonne , j’aime beaucoup cette distrib d’audit internet :wink: :wink: ya plus qu’a … héhé :wink: :wink:

au faite sur la 4 compiz est present ??? pour le wifi , je sais que ce n’est plus wireless assistant/network manager dedans mais wicd par contre par rapport a la 3 la 4 a eu du mal a se connecter en wifi mais bon !!! :wink:[/quote]

Non pas de compiz. Mais ce n’est pas ce qu’on lui demande :wink: